A hollow metal tube is a cylindrical metal structure that has a hollow interior. It can be made from a variety of metals, including steel, aluminum, copper, and titanium, depending on the specific requirements of the application. The tube can be seamless or welded, with different manufacturing processes used to achieve the desired properties and dimensions.

One of the primary uses of the hollow metal tube is in construction. Steel tubes are commonly used in building structures, such as bridges, skyscrapers, and stadiums, due to their high strength and durability. The hollow nature of the tube allows it to support heavy loads while remaining lightweight, making it an ideal choice for structural applications. In addition, metal tubes can be easily formed and welded to create complex shapes and designs, providing architects and engineers with flexibility in their designs.

In the automotive industry, hollow metal tubes are utilized in the manufacturing of vehicle chassis, exhaust systems, and suspension components. Steel tubes are preferred for their strength and impact resistance, making them suitable for withstanding the harsh environments encountered on the road. Aluminum tubes are also commonly used in automotive applications due to their lightweight nature, which helps improve fuel efficiency and overall vehicle performance.

Another important application of the hollow metal tube is in the furniture industry. Metal tubes are often used as the framework for chairs, tables, and shelves, providing structural support while maintaining a modern and sleek appearance. The tubes can be powder-coated or painted in various colors to match different design aesthetics, making them a popular choice for contemporary furniture designs.

In the field of industrial equipment, hollow metal tubes are used for conveying fluids, gases, and electrical wiring. Steel tubes are commonly employed in the construction of pipelines, heat exchangers, and pressure vessels due to their corrosion resistance and high temperature tolerance. Copper tubes, on the other hand, are preferred for their excellent conductivity and thermal properties, making them ideal for electrical wiring and heat transfer applications.

The aerospace industry also relies on hollow metal tubes for various applications, such as in the construction of aircraft fuselages, wings, and landing gear. Aluminum and titanium tubes are commonly used in aerospace applications due to their lightweight nature and high strength-to-weight ratio, which are critical factors in aircraft design. The tubes are often subjected to rigorous testing and quality control measures to ensure they meet the strict safety requirements of the aerospace industry.

In the realm of art and sculpture, hollow metal tubes are often used by artists and designers to create unique and innovative pieces. The tubes can be bent, twisted, and welded together to form intricate shapes and structures, providing a versatile medium for creative expression. From large-scale installations to small-scale sculptures, metal tubes offer endless possibilities for artistic exploration.
